欧美在线观看视频网站,亚洲熟妇色自偷自拍另类,啪啪伊人网,中文字幕第13亚洲另类,中文成人久久久久影院免费观看 ,精品人妻人人做人人爽,亚洲a视频

模具設計增量復制的系統(tǒng)及方法

文檔序號:6615250閱讀:223來源:國知局
專利名稱:模具設計增量復制的系統(tǒng)及方法
技術領域
本發(fā)明涉及一種增量復制的系統(tǒng)及方法,尤其指模具設計中的增量復制的系統(tǒng)及方法。
背景技術
模具設計中存在非常多的零件圖形,有些圖形部分一樣但是圖形中存在的數字或編號卻 以某個增量遞增變化。還有一部分圖形只有數字或字母編號,但是這些數字或編號也同樣以 某增量遞增變化,見圖1中的標號1和2處所示。設計者在繪制這些零件圖形或數字和字母的 時候,要么將其中一個圖形復制后修改其中變化的部分數字或字母,要么重新一點點繪制。 不管設計者使用哪種方式都會花費比較多的時間來完成,特別是在圖形復雜量大的時候。
目前在輔助繪圖工具方面有一些簡單的功能能夠實現單項字符串最后一位數字按照規(guī)定 的增量值進行增加的這種情形的復制,而其遠遠不能夠適應模具設計中千變萬化的摻雜各種 復雜圖形增量復制的需求。

發(fā)明內容
鑒于以上內容,本發(fā)明提供一種模具設計增量復制方法,用于被復制圖形中的數字或字 符按照給定增量值變化,從而復制圖形。
該模具設計增量復制方法包括步驟從模具設計圖檔中選擇需復制的圖形并復制該圖形 到剪貼板中;從該圖形所有字符串中選擇復制過程中要變化的字符串;從要變化的字符串中 選擇要變化的字符;設定該要變化字符的變化增量值或遞減值;以設定的增量值修改剪貼板 中的圖形上要變化的字符;獲取上述所選擇圖形的最小包圍核并將該最小包圍核的幾何中心 作為粘貼基準點;以該粘貼基準點為基準選擇粘貼插入點;以該粘貼插入點為中心粘貼上述 剪貼板中的圖形到該模具設計圖檔上。
鑒于以上內容,本發(fā)明還提供一種模具設計增量復制系統(tǒng),用于被復制圖形中的數字或 字符按照給定增量值變化,從而復制圖形。
該模具設計增量復制系統(tǒng)包括選擇模塊,用于將在模具設計圖檔中選擇的圖形復制到 剪貼板中;獲取模塊,用于獲取所選擇圖形中的所有字符串;該選擇模塊,還用于從上述字 符串中選擇復制過程中要變化的字符串,及從要變化的字符串中選擇要變化的字符;設定模 塊,用于設定要變化字符的變化增量值或遞減值;修改模塊,用于以設定的增量值修改剪貼 板中的圖形上的要變化的字符;該獲取模塊,還用于獲取所選擇圖形的最小包圍核,并得到該最小包圍核的幾何中心,以該幾何中心作為被復制圖形的粘貼基準點;粘貼模塊,用于以 上述粘貼基準點為基準選擇粘貼插入點,以該粘貼插入點為中心粘貼上述剪貼板中的圖形到 該模具設計圖檔上。
本發(fā)明所提供的模具設計增量復制系統(tǒng)及方法能夠適應模具輔助設計中圖形的復雜的增 量復制需求,可以自動讀取設計者選擇的圖形當中的字符串,并讓設計者選擇要變化的字符 及設定定增量值或遞減值,按照設定的增量值或遞減值修改要變化的字符,同時自動計算所 選擇圖形的幾何中心點作為復制粘貼基準點,再選擇插入點后粘貼該修改完變化字符的圖形 到該插入點且還支持多次連續(xù)復制操作,增強了傳統(tǒng)的復制功能。


圖l為圖形部分存在的數字或字母以某增量變化的示意圖。
圖2為本發(fā)明模具設計增量復制系統(tǒng)較佳實施例的功能模塊圖。
圖3為本發(fā)明模具設計增量復制方法的流程圖
圖4為本發(fā)明一個圖形的最小包圍核的示意圖。
具體實施例方式
參閱圖2所示,是本發(fā)明模具設計增量復制系統(tǒng)較佳實施例的功能模塊圖。該模具設計 增量復制系統(tǒng)10可運行在任一臺安裝有模具具設計軟件的計算機中運行。
該模具設計增量復制系統(tǒng)10包括選擇模塊101,獲取模塊102,設定模塊103,修改模塊 104,及粘貼模塊105。
該選擇模塊101用于在模具設計圖檔中選擇需復制的圖形并將該選擇的圖形復制到剪貼 板中。
該獲取模塊102用于獲取所選擇圖形中的所有字符串。本發(fā)明中的字符串是指包含有數 字和字母的至少一種組合的字符串該字符串可以只包數含數字,或者只包含字母,或者包含 數字和字母的組合,如圖1中的P01A-P01, P01A-P02, P01A-P03。所述字符串在模具設計中 屬于模具圖形中的文字輸入內容,即模具圖形中作為特殊的存儲內容存在,和模具圖形、模 具加工屬性一樣存在模具圖檔數據庫中。當設計者選擇了要復制的圖形后,該獲取模塊102 從圖檔數據庫中査找到所選擇圖形的數據庫檢索索引,用字符串類型開啟該得到的圖形檢索 索引對應的圖形,該所開啟的圖形即為圖形中的字符串。
該選擇模塊101用于從上述獲取的字符串中選擇復制過程中要變化的字符串,及從所選 擇的要變化的字符串中選擇要變化的字符。
設定模塊103用于設定要變化字符的變化增量值或遞減值。本較佳實施例以增量值為例進行說明。
修改模塊104用于以設定的增量值修改剪貼板中的圖形上的要變化的字符串中的要變化 的字符。
該獲取模塊102還用于獲取在該模具設計圖檔上所選擇圖形的最小包圍核,并得到該最 小包圍核的幾何中心,作為被復制到剪貼板中的圖形的粘貼基準點,該幾何中心即兩對角線 相交點。見圖4所示為一個圖形的最小包圍核的示意圖。所述最小包圍核是能夠包圍住該圖 形的最小矩形,且該矩形的長寬分別和國際坐標系中X軸及Y軸平行,也即該矩形的長是水平 的,寬是垂直的。圖4中所示的矩形框即是其所包圍的橢圓的最小包圍核。在得到所選擇的 圖形的最小包圍核后,取得其最小包圍核四個頂點(ABCD)的坐標,接著求出兩對角線AC和 BD的交點O即為最小包圍核的中心,同時也是對應設計者所選擇圖形的幾何中心。
粘貼模塊105用于以上述基準點為基準在該模具設計圖檔上選擇粘貼插入點,以該粘貼 插入點為中心粘貼上述剪貼板中的圖形。
參閱圖3所示,是本發(fā)明模具設計增量復制方法的流程圖。
步驟S200,選擇模塊101從模具設計圖檔中選擇需復制的圖形并復制該選擇的圖形到剪 貼板中。
步驟S202,獲取模塊102獲取該所選擇圖形中的所有字符串。也即,該獲取模塊102從圖 檔數據庫中査找到所選擇圖形的數據庫檢索索弓1 ,用字符串類型開啟該得到的圖形檢索索弓1 對應的圖形,該所開啟的圖形即為該所復制的圖形中的字符串。
步驟S204,選擇模塊101從上述獲取的所有字符串中選擇在復制過程中要變化的字符串
步驟S206,該選擇模塊l01從上述選擇的要變化的字符串中選擇要變化的字符。 步驟S208,設定模塊103設定上述要變化字符的變化增量值。
步驟S210,修改模塊104以該設定的變化增量值修改所述剪貼板中的圖形中要變化的字符。
步驟S212,獲取模塊102獲取所選擇圖形的最小包圍核。所述最小包圍核是能夠包圍住 該圖形的最小矩形,且該矩形的長和寬分別和國際坐標系中X軸及Y軸平行,也即該矩形的長 是水平的,該矩形的寬是垂直的。圖4中所示的矩形框即是其所包圍的橢圓的最小包圍核。 在得到所選擇的圖形的最小包圍核后,取得其最小包圍核四個頂點(ABCD)的坐標,接著求 出兩對角線AC和BD的交點O即為最小包圍核的中心,該交點O同時也是對應設計者所選擇圖形 的幾何中心。步驟S214,該獲取模塊l02得到該獲取的最小包圍核的幾何中心,作為粘貼基準點。 步驟S216,粘貼模塊105以該粘貼基準點為基準在該模具設計圖檔上選擇粘貼插入點。 步驟S218,該粘貼模塊l05以該粘貼插入點為中心粘貼所述剪貼板中的圖形到該模具設 計圖檔上。
步驟S220,該復制模塊105判斷是否還需要繼續(xù)復制該所選擇的圖形。當不需要復制時 ,退出該流程。
步驟S222,當需要繼續(xù)復制時,由修改模塊104以所設定的變化增量值修改要變化的字 符,然后返回步驟S216。
權利要求
權利要求1一種模具設計增量復制方法,其特征在于,該方法包括步驟從模具設計圖檔中選擇需復制的圖形并復制該圖形到剪貼板中;從該圖形所有字符串中選擇復制過程中要變化的字符串;從要變化的字符串中選擇要變化的字符;設定該要變化字符的變化增量值或遞減值;以設定的增量值或遞減值修改剪貼板中的圖形上的要變化的字符;獲取上述所選擇圖形的最小包圍核并將該最小包圍核的幾何中心作為粘貼基準點;以該粘貼基準點為基準在該模具設計圖檔上選擇粘貼插入點;以該粘貼插入點為中心粘貼上述剪貼板中的圖形。
2.如權利要求l所述的模具設計增量復制方法,其特征在于,該方法 還包括步驟判斷是否還要繼續(xù)復制該選擇的圖形;如果需要繼續(xù)復制該選擇的圖形,則以設定的增量值修改剪貼板中的圖形上要變化的 字符,并返回以該粘貼基準點為基準在該模具設計圖檔上選擇粘貼插入點的步驟。
3.如權利要求l所述的模具設計增量復制方法,其特征在于,所述字 符串包含數字和字母中的至少一種組合,所述要變化的字符指數字或字母。
4.如權利要求l所述的模具設計增量復制方法,其特征在于,所述圖 形的最小包圍核是能夠包圍住該圖形的最小矩形,且該矩形的長是水平的,寬是垂直的。
5.如權利要求l所述的模具設計增量復制方法,其特征在于,所述最 小包圍核的幾何中心是該最小包圍核的兩對角線的交點。
6. 一種模具設計增量復制系統(tǒng),其特征在于,該系統(tǒng)包括 選擇模塊,用于將在模具設計圖檔中選擇的圖形復制到剪貼板中; 獲取模塊,用于獲取所選擇圖形中的所有字符串;該選擇模塊,還用于從上述字符串中選擇復制過程中要變化的字符串,及從要變化的字符串中選擇要變化的字符;設定模塊,用于設定要變化字符的變化增量值或遞減值;修改模塊,用于以設定的增量值修改剪貼板中圖形上的要變化的字符;該獲取模塊,還用于獲取所選擇圖形的最小包圍核,并得到該最小包圍核的幾何中心,作為粘貼基準點;粘貼模塊,用于以上述粘貼基準點為基準選擇粘貼插入點,以該粘貼插入點為中心粘 貼上述剪貼板中的圖形。
7 如權利要求6所述的模具設計增量復制系統(tǒng),其特征在于,所述字 符串包含數字和字母中的至少一種組合,所述要變化的字符指數字或字母。
8 如權利要求6所述的模具設計增量復制系統(tǒng),其特征在于,所述圖 形的最小包圍核是能夠包圍住該圖形的最小的矩形,且該矩形的長是水平的,寬是垂直的。
9 如權利要求6所述的模具設計增量復制系統(tǒng),其特征在于,所述最 小包圍核的幾何中心是該最小包圍核的兩對角線的交點。
全文摘要
本發(fā)明提供一種模具設計增量復制方法,包括步驟從模具設計圖檔中選擇需復制的圖形并復制該圖形到剪貼板中;從該圖形中所有字符串中選擇復制過程中要變化的字符串;從要變化的字符串中選擇要變化的字符;設定該要變化字符的變化增量值或遞減值;以設定的增量值修改剪貼板中的圖形上要變化的字符;獲取上述選擇的圖形的最小包圍核并將該最小包圍核的幾何中心作為粘貼基準點;以該粘貼基準點為基準在該模具設計圖檔上選擇粘貼插入點;以該粘貼插入點為中心粘貼上述剪貼板中的圖形到該模具設計圖檔上。本發(fā)明還提供一種模具設計增量復制系統(tǒng)。本發(fā)明能夠適應模具輔助設計中遇到的復雜的增量復制需求。
文檔編號G06F17/50GK101414315SQ20071020213
公開日2009年4月22日 申請日期2007年10月18日 優(yōu)先權日2007年10月18日
發(fā)明者常春明 申請人:鴻富錦精密工業(yè)(深圳)有限公司;鴻海精密工業(yè)股份有限公司
網友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1
万安县| 巴中市| 阿拉尔市| 永仁县| 沈丘县| 门源| 文水县| 龙海市| 汉阴县| 孟连| 临洮县| 宁南县| 荥阳市| 库伦旗| 黄大仙区| 岐山县| 六安市| 蓬安县| 卢龙县| 寻甸| 公安县| 博白县| 德安县| 陆丰市| 五原县| 屯留县| 三原县| 乐安县| 景宁| 双峰县| 松桃| 西丰县| 金阳县| 墨江| 延边| 南郑县| 建阳市| 平远县| 阳曲县| 长顺县| 林西县|